WebbThis is the complete 18 Volume set (plus the Christmas Annual) of the Victorian Erotic magazine. The Pearl was a relatively short lived magazine published in London between 1879 to 1880 (whereupon it was shut down for publishing rude and obscene literature.) This book has 832 pages in the PDF version, and was originally published in the 1800's. WebbThe Pearl John Steinbeck Home Literature Notes The Pearl Book Summary Book Summary Kino, the novella's protagonist, is a young Mexican-Indian pearl diver married to Juana; they have a baby named Coyotito. Their lives seem rather peaceful, but their tranquility is threatened when a scorpion bites Coyotito.
